rev |
line source |
meillo@0
|
1 .do xflag 3
|
meillo@0
|
2 .de __
|
meillo@0
|
3 ..
|
meillo@0
|
4 .blm __ \" ignore empty lines in input
|
meillo@0
|
5 .lc_ctype en_US.utf8
|
meillo@0
|
6 .mediasize a4
|
meillo@0
|
7
|
meillo@0
|
8 .fp 1 R LinLibertine_R otf
|
meillo@0
|
9 .feature R +onum
|
meillo@0
|
10 .fp 2 I LinLibertine_RI otf
|
meillo@0
|
11 .feature I +onum
|
meillo@0
|
12 .fp 3 B LinLibertine_RB otf
|
meillo@0
|
13 .feature B +onum
|
meillo@0
|
14 .fp 4 BI LinLibertine_RBI otf
|
meillo@0
|
15 .feature BI +onum
|
meillo@0
|
16 .fp 5 CW TerminusMedium-4.36 ttf
|
meillo@0
|
17 .fp 0 CI TerminusMediumItalic-4.36 ttf
|
meillo@0
|
18 .fp 0 CB TerminusBold-4.36 ttf
|
meillo@0
|
19 .fp 0 L TerminusMedium-4.36 ttf
|
meillo@15
|
20 .fp 0 SC LinLibertine_R otf
|
meillo@15
|
21 .feature SC +onum +smcp
|
meillo@15
|
22 .fp 0 IC LinLibertine_RI otf
|
meillo@15
|
23 .feature IC +onum +smcp
|
meillo@0
|
24 .fp 0 BC LinLibertine_RB otf
|
meillo@0
|
25 .feature BC +onum +smcp
|
meillo@0
|
26
|
meillo@0
|
27 .ig
|
meillo@0
|
28 . nr PS 10
|
meillo@0
|
29 . nr VS 12
|
meillo@0
|
30 ..
|
meillo@0
|
31
|
meillo@0
|
32 .nr PI 3n
|
meillo@41
|
33 .nr PD .3v
|
meillo@0
|
34 .nr lu 0
|
meillo@0
|
35 .af PN i
|
meillo@0
|
36
|
meillo@15
|
37 .ds _E '\\\\n(PN''\f(SCMarkus Schnalke: The Modern Mail Handler\fP' \" left
|
meillo@15
|
38 .ds _O '\f(SCChapter \\\\n(H1\ \ \\\\*(_C\fP''\\\\n(PN' \" right
|
meillo@29
|
39 .ds _o '\f(SC\\\\*(_C\fP''\\\\n(PN' \" right
|
meillo@0
|
40 .ds CH "
|
meillo@0
|
41
|
meillo@0
|
42 .nr HM 3.3c
|
meillo@0
|
43 .nr FM 6.6c
|
meillo@0
|
44 .nr LL 14c
|
meillo@0
|
45 .ll 14c
|
meillo@0
|
46 .nr LT \n(LL
|
meillo@64
|
47 .if t .nr PO 2.3c
|
meillo@0
|
48
|
meillo@0
|
49 .de _M \" change margins for text block on next page
|
meillo@64
|
50 .if t .if e .nr PO -2.3c
|
meillo@64
|
51 .if t .if o .nr PO +2.3c
|
meillo@0
|
52 .ds CF "
|
meillo@0
|
53 ..
|
meillo@0
|
54 .wh -1u _M
|
meillo@0
|
55
|
meillo@0
|
56 .de CW
|
meillo@0
|
57 .nr PQ \\n(.f
|
meillo@0
|
58 .if t \{\
|
meillo@0
|
59 . ft CW
|
meillo@0
|
60 . if !^\\$1^^ \&\\$1\f\\n(PQ\\$2
|
meillo@0
|
61 .\}
|
meillo@0
|
62 .if n \{\
|
meillo@0
|
63 . ie ^\\$1^^ .ul 999
|
meillo@0
|
64 . el .ul 1
|
meillo@0
|
65 . if \\n(.$=1 \&\\$1
|
meillo@0
|
66 . if \\n(.$>1 \&\\$1\c
|
meillo@0
|
67 . if \\n(.$>1 \&\\$2
|
meillo@0
|
68 .\}
|
meillo@0
|
69 ..
|
meillo@0
|
70
|
meillo@35
|
71 .ds [. " [
|
meillo@0
|
72 .ds .] ]
|
meillo@0
|
73 .rm ]<
|
meillo@0
|
74 .de ]<
|
meillo@0
|
75 . LP
|
meillo@0
|
76 . de FP
|
meillo@0
|
77 . IP \\\\$1.
|
meillo@0
|
78 \\..
|
meillo@0
|
79 . rm FS FE
|
meillo@0
|
80 ..
|
meillo@0
|
81
|
meillo@0
|
82 .am PT
|
meillo@0
|
83 . rs
|
meillo@0
|
84 ..
|
meillo@0
|
85
|
meillo@0
|
86 .rm NH
|
meillo@0
|
87 .de NH
|
meillo@0
|
88 .SH
|
meillo@0
|
89 .nr NS \\$1
|
meillo@0
|
90 .if !\\n(.$ .nr NS 1
|
meillo@0
|
91 .if !\\n(NS .nr NS 1
|
meillo@0
|
92 .nr H\\n(NS +1
|
meillo@6
|
93 .if \\n(NS<2 .nr H2 0
|
meillo@6
|
94 .if \\n(NS<3 .nr H3 0
|
meillo@0
|
95 .ds SN \\n(H1
|
meillo@6
|
96 .if \\n(NS>1 .as SN \&.\\n(H2
|
meillo@6
|
97 .if \\n(NS>2 .as SN \&.\\n(H3
|
meillo@0
|
98 ..
|
meillo@0
|
99
|
meillo@40
|
100 .de H-
|
meillo@29
|
101 .EH "
|
meillo@29
|
102 .OH "
|
meillo@29
|
103 .bp
|
meillo@44
|
104 .rs
|
meillo@29
|
105 .if e .bp
|
meillo@29
|
106 .lg 0
|
meillo@29
|
107 .nr PS +6
|
meillo@29
|
108 .nr VS +6
|
meillo@29
|
109 .SH
|
meillo@29
|
110 .ce 1
|
meillo@29
|
111 .tr aAbBcCdDeEfFgGhHiIjJkKlLmMnNoOpPqQrRsStTuUvVwWxXyYzZ
|
meillo@29
|
112 \&\\$1
|
meillo@29
|
113 .br
|
meillo@29
|
114 .tr aabbccddeeffgghhiijjkkllmmnnooppqqrrssttuuvvwwxxyyzz
|
meillo@29
|
115 .nr PS -6
|
meillo@29
|
116 .nr VS -6
|
meillo@29
|
117 .lg
|
meillo@29
|
118 .RT
|
meillo@40
|
119 .if !,\\$2,no, \{
|
meillo@40
|
120 . EH "\\\\*(_E
|
meillo@40
|
121 . ie \\n(H1 .OH "\\\\*(_O
|
meillo@40
|
122 . el .OH "\\\\*(_o
|
meillo@40
|
123 . ds CF \\n(PN
|
meillo@40
|
124 .\}
|
meillo@29
|
125 .sp 4
|
meillo@29
|
126 .nr PP 0
|
meillo@29
|
127 ..
|
meillo@29
|
128
|
meillo@0
|
129 .de H0
|
meillo@0
|
130 .EH "
|
meillo@0
|
131 .OH "
|
meillo@0
|
132 .bp
|
meillo@44
|
133 .rs
|
meillo@0
|
134 .if e .bp
|
meillo@0
|
135 . lg 0
|
meillo@0
|
136 . nr PS +6
|
meillo@0
|
137 . nr VS +6
|
meillo@35
|
138 .ie \\n(.$=1 \{\
|
meillo@0
|
139 . NH 1
|
meillo@0
|
140 . ce 1
|
meillo@0
|
141 Chapter \\*(SN
|
meillo@0
|
142 . sp .5
|
meillo@0
|
143 .\}
|
meillo@35
|
144 .el .if ,\\$2,no, .SH
|
meillo@0
|
145 . ce 1
|
meillo@0
|
146 . tr aAbBcCdDeEfFgGhHiIjJkKlLmMnNoOpPqQrRsStTuUvVwWxXyYzZ
|
meillo@0
|
147 \&\\$1
|
meillo@0
|
148 . br
|
meillo@0
|
149 . tr aabbccddeeffgghhiijjkkllmmnnooppqqrrssttuuvvwwxxyyzz
|
meillo@0
|
150 . nr PS -6
|
meillo@0
|
151 . nr VS -6
|
meillo@0
|
152 . lg
|
meillo@0
|
153 .ds _C "\\$1
|
meillo@0
|
154 . RT
|
meillo@0
|
155 . XS
|
meillo@0
|
156 . sp .5v
|
meillo@0
|
157 . B
|
meillo@35
|
158 .ie \\n(.$=1 \{\
|
meillo@46
|
159 \\*(SN \\$1
|
meillo@0
|
160 .\}
|
meillo@35
|
161 .el .if ,\\$2,no, \&\\$1
|
meillo@0
|
162 . XE
|
meillo@29
|
163 .EH "\\\\*(_E
|
meillo@29
|
164 .ie \\n(H1 .OH "\\\\*(_O
|
meillo@29
|
165 .el .OH "\\\\*(_o
|
meillo@29
|
166 .ds CF \\n(PN
|
meillo@0
|
167 .sp 4
|
meillo@0
|
168 .nr PP 0
|
meillo@0
|
169 ..
|
meillo@0
|
170
|
meillo@39
|
171
|
meillo@39
|
172 .\" Reset page Numbers, set page number format ($1) and move to a right page.
|
meillo@39
|
173 .de RN
|
meillo@39
|
174 .ie e .pn 1
|
meillo@39
|
175 .el \{
|
meillo@39
|
176 . pn 0
|
meillo@39
|
177 . bp
|
meillo@39
|
178 .\}
|
meillo@39
|
179 .ie \\n(.$=1 .af PN \\$1
|
meillo@39
|
180 .el .af PN 1
|
meillo@39
|
181 ..
|
meillo@39
|
182
|
meillo@39
|
183
|
meillo@0
|
184 .de H1
|
meillo@0
|
185 .br
|
meillo@0
|
186 .ne 7
|
meillo@1
|
187 .sp
|
meillo@0
|
188 . nr PS +2
|
meillo@0
|
189 . nr VS +2
|
meillo@6
|
190 .if '\\$2'no' .SH
|
meillo@6
|
191 .if \\n(.$=1 .NH 2
|
meillo@0
|
192 . lg 0
|
meillo@0
|
193 . tr aAbBcCdDeEfFgGhHiIjJkKlLmMnNoOpPqQrRsStTuUvVwWxXyYzZ
|
meillo@6
|
194 .if !'\\$2'no' \&\\*(SN
|
meillo@6
|
195 \\$1
|
meillo@0
|
196 . br
|
meillo@0
|
197 . tr aabbccddeeffgghhiijjkkllmmnnooppqqrrssttuuvvwwxxyyzz
|
meillo@0
|
198 . nr PS -2
|
meillo@0
|
199 . nr VS -2
|
meillo@0
|
200 . lg
|
meillo@0
|
201 . RT
|
meillo@6
|
202 .if !'\\$2'no' \{\
|
meillo@0
|
203 .ds _S "\\$1
|
meillo@0
|
204 . XS
|
meillo@59
|
205 . sp .3v
|
meillo@0
|
206 \\*(SN \\$1
|
meillo@0
|
207 . XE
|
meillo@6
|
208 .\}
|
meillo@6
|
209 .nr PP 0
|
meillo@6
|
210 ..
|
meillo@6
|
211
|
meillo@6
|
212 .de H2
|
meillo@6
|
213 .br
|
meillo@7
|
214 .ne 4
|
meillo@59
|
215 .NH 3
|
meillo@11
|
216 \&\\*(SN
|
meillo@6
|
217 \\$1
|
meillo@11
|
218 .RT
|
meillo@6
|
219 .ds _S "\\$1
|
meillo@11
|
220 .XS
|
meillo@59
|
221 \\*(SN \\$1
|
meillo@11
|
222 .XE
|
meillo@11
|
223 .nr PP 0
|
meillo@11
|
224 ..
|
meillo@11
|
225
|
meillo@11
|
226 .de U2
|
meillo@11
|
227 .br
|
meillo@11
|
228 .ne 4
|
meillo@11
|
229 .SH
|
meillo@11
|
230 \\$1
|
meillo@11
|
231 .RT
|
meillo@0
|
232 .nr PP 0
|
meillo@0
|
233 ..
|
meillo@0
|
234
|
meillo@0
|
235 .de P
|
meillo@0
|
236 .ie \\n(PP .PP
|
meillo@0
|
237 .el .LP
|
meillo@0
|
238 .nr PP 1
|
meillo@0
|
239 ..
|
meillo@0
|
240
|
meillo@0
|
241 .am IP
|
meillo@0
|
242 .nr PP 0
|
meillo@0
|
243 ..
|
meillo@0
|
244
|
meillo@6
|
245 .de BU
|
meillo@6
|
246 .IP \(bu
|
meillo@6
|
247 ..
|
meillo@6
|
248
|
meillo@0
|
249 .am QP
|
meillo@0
|
250 .ps -1
|
meillo@0
|
251 ..
|
meillo@0
|
252
|
meillo@0
|
253 .am DS
|
meillo@0
|
254 .ft CW
|
meillo@0
|
255 .ps -1
|
meillo@0
|
256 .ta T 8n
|
meillo@0
|
257 ..
|
meillo@0
|
258
|
meillo@0
|
259 .am FA
|
meillo@0
|
260 .ps 8
|
meillo@0
|
261 .vs 9
|
meillo@0
|
262 ..
|
meillo@18
|
263
|
meillo@18
|
264 .de Fn \" file name
|
meillo@18
|
265 .CW "\\$1" "\\$2
|
meillo@18
|
266 ..
|
meillo@18
|
267 .de Pn \" program name
|
meillo@18
|
268 .CW "\\$1" "\\$2
|
meillo@18
|
269 ..
|
meillo@18
|
270 .de Fu \" function
|
meillo@18
|
271 .CW "\\$1" "\\$2
|
meillo@18
|
272 ..
|
meillo@19
|
273 .de Ev \" env variable
|
meillo@19
|
274 .CW "\\$1" "\\$2
|
meillo@19
|
275 ..
|
meillo@18
|
276 .de Cl \" command line
|
meillo@18
|
277 `\c
|
meillo@18
|
278 .CW "\\$1" "'\\$2
|
meillo@18
|
279 ..
|
meillo@18
|
280 .de Sw \" switch
|
meillo@18
|
281 .CW "\\$1" "\\$2
|
meillo@18
|
282 ..
|
meillo@18
|
283 .de Mp \" man page
|
meillo@18
|
284 .I "\\$1" "\\$2
|
meillo@18
|
285 ..
|
meillo@18
|
286 .de Pe \" profile entry
|
meillo@18
|
287 .CW "\\$1" "\\$2
|
meillo@18
|
288 ..
|
meillo@67
|
289
|
meillo@67
|
290 .de Ci \" commit ref
|
meillo@70
|
291 .ds _t \\$1
|
meillo@70
|
292 .substring _t 0 6
|
meillo@67
|
293 [\(rh
|
meillo@70
|
294 .CW "\\*(_t" "]\\$2
|
meillo@67
|
295 ..
|